A Comprehensive Guide to Casement Window Installation Casement windows are a popular choice amongst house owners due to their ability to provide outstanding ventilation, unobstructed views, and improved energy efficiency. They are depended upon one side and swing outside, permitting a complete opening that can catch breezes from various angles. Setting up casement windows can be a satisfying job, whether a house owner is replacing old systems or setting up brand-new ones. Intro to Casement Windows Casement windows vary from standard sliding or double-hung windows in several methods. Mainly, they are developed to open outside, which permits higher airflow. This kind of window also provides better sealing due to its sash that presses versus the frame when closed, improving energy performance and preventing drafts.
Advantages of Casement Windows: Increased Ventilation: The full opening of casement windows enables optimum air movement. Unobstructed Views: Since they open outside, they do not take up space within the space, thus providing a clear view. Energy Efficiency: Casement windows can use better insulation compared to standard window types. 2. Tools and Materials Needed Before starting the installation, gather the following tools and products:
Tools: Tape measure Level Hammer Screwdriver (both Phillips and flathead) Pry bar Power drill Caulking gun Utility knife Security goggles and gloves Materials: Casement window system Shims (wood or composite) Insulation foam or fiberglass Exterior-grade caulk Screws (specific to window type and installation) 3. Steps to Install Casement Windows Preparation Procedure the Opening:
Use a tape step to determine the width and height of the window opening. It is vital to determine at 3 different points (top, middle, and bottom for width; left, middle, and right for height) to guarantee a precise fit. Select the Right Window:
Choose a casement window that fits the measurements acquired. Confirm that it satisfies local building codes and energy performance scores. Eliminate the Old Window (if relevant):
If replacing an old window, carefully remove it by spying away any trim and cutting through the caulk. Beware not to harm the surrounding wall. Installation Process Prepare the Opening:
Clean the window opening, eliminating old caulk, particles, or harmed products. Ensure the opening is square by checking the alignment with a level. If it runs out square, use shims to adjust. Place the Window:
With assistance, raise the casement window into the opening. Depending on the type of window, place it from the interior side. The bottom of the window ought to rest on the sill. Level and Shim:
Use a level to guarantee the window is completely aligned. visit website with shims as required to make the window level. Shims must be placed at the corners and the middle of each side. Protect the Window:
Once the window is level, usage screws to secure it in place. Pre-drill holes to avoid the frame from splitting. Follow the producer's guidelines for specific spacing and variety of screws. Insulate and Seal:
Fill any gaps around the window frame with insulation foam or fiberglass, making sure not to overfill. Then, apply a bead of exterior-grade caulk around the window frame to seal it from prospective water invasion. Final Adjustments Inspect the Operation:
Open and close the window to guarantee it operates efficiently without any obstructions. Adjust hinges if essential. Install the Trim:
Once whatever remains in place and working properly, install any outside or interior trim. This will improve the looks and cover any exposed framing or shims. 4. Maintenance Tips for Casement Windows To keep casement windows performing optimally, routine upkeep is needed.
Upkeep Checklist: Inspect Seals and Caulk: Annually look for wear and reapply caulk if essential to maintain energy effectiveness. Clean Frames and Glass: Use a moderate cleaning agent to clean up the glass and wipe down the frames. Prevent abrasive products that may scratch. Oil Hinges: Periodically apply a lubricant to the hinges to keep the window functioning efficiently. Inspect for Damage: Regularly check for fractures, warps, or any indications of wear and tear and address them immediately. 5. Frequently Asked Questions about Casement Window Installation Q1: What are the benefits of casement windows over other types? Casement windows provide superior ventilation, are easy to operate, and improve energy effectiveness through their tight seals when closed.
Q2: Can I set up casement windows by myself? While an experienced DIYer might successfully install casement windows alone, it is advisable to have support to handle the size and weight of the windows safely.
Q3: How do I know which size window to purchase? Use the measurements of your window opening, taken at numerous points, to choose the correctly sized window. Make sure to check maker suggestions for variations in size.
Q4: What if my window opening is not square? If your window opening isn't square, you can use shims during the installation procedure to make the necessary modifications.
Q5: How frequently should I preserve casement windows? It's recommended to inspect and keep casement windows a minimum of once a year to guarantee durability and performance.
